Conclusion
Shimano 21 Stradic SW 5000 XGX clearly outshines Shimano Sedona FJ 4000FJX, offering significantly better performance in ball bearings (7) and durability (8.8 out of 10). While Shimano Sedona FJ 4000FJX may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ano 21 Stradic SW 5000 XGX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
